    Insurance claim/Hail

    I got hail damage to my dodge truck. It has been paid off for years. Germania insurance want to make my check out to me and the body shop I am getting it repaired at. I want the check made out to only me since there is not lean holder and I can get it repaired when and where I want to.

    Do I have a choice or is there some requirement / law that says they have to make it out to me and the body shop.

            #6
            Going through hail damage claim with State Farm. They asked if I wanted check sent to me or body shop, not both. Insurance will always under estimate & body shop will have to ask for supplement to get more $ from insurance to cover the work. Not sure about your insurance but State Farm is not doing any in person estimates/adjustments so that affects their ability to estimate. Going to be hard for them to see all the hail damage in just a few photos.

                        #12
                        An insurance contract is there to return your property to pre-loss condition. By law you’re not supposed to be able to profit from a claim so they’re probably just wanting to make sure you’re using the money for the repairs.
